The legendary wrestling announcer Jim Ross has officially inked a new contract with All Elite Wrestling (AEW), as announced on the latest episode of Grilling JR podcast. Ross revealed that the new deal is not an extension of his current deal, but an entirely fresh contract with the company. He called it a quick and straightforward negotiation process.
According to reports, the veteran broadcaster's original contract had expired on February 14, prompting discussions for a renewal. Ross explained on the show that things came together quickly and the two sides worked promptly during negotiations. "It was probably the quickest and easiest negotiation I have ever done in my career of 50 years," he said. Ross added that Khan has always been a fan which helped his cause. He noted that the AEW President showed his appreciation to Ross' role as a broadcaster and committed more time to Ross with the new deal.
While speaking about the new role he's going to take on, he noted, “I assume it's going to be centered around the pay-per-views, we’re adding more pay-per-views." And, with AEW expanding the amount of pay-per-views they'll be offering, it makes sense to have Jim Ross a part of the new events. He explained:
I think we’re down for another year. That’s plenty. I’m happy with it. Tony Khan stepped up. Term wise, financial package wise, everything was to my liking. I was very blessed to be working with Tony on that deal. He wanted me signed. He got his man and I got my company. It all worked out real well.
Expect Ross To Have a More Limited Role in AEW Moving Forward
Having faced health challenges recently, Ross made a triumphant return to AEW television at the Revolution pay-per-view, where he called the final two matches of the show. His presence and commentary added to the significance of the event, which included Sting's retirement. As for how much his health issues will affect the amount of future work he can do, he said he remains committed to his role in AEW and expressed optimism about reaching a new agreement.
While the future of Ross's health remains a priority, the renewed contract ensures his continued involvement with AEW. His veteran experience will play a pivotal role in making those events memorable for fans.
